操作系统。
一、选择题(20小题,每题1分,共20分)
1.在设计实施操作系统时,(c)不是主要追求的目标。
a、及时响应
b、安全可靠。
c、提高资源利用率
d、快速处理。
2.下列操作系统中,交互性最强的是:(c)
a、批处理操作系统
b、实时操作系统。
c、分时操作系统
d、网络操作系统。
3.当操作系统选择某用户程序占用cpu时,则cpu的状态(b)
a、从目态转换成管态
b、从管态转成目态。
c、继续保持目态。
d、继续保持管态。
4.若干进程可同时执行的,它们轮流占用处理交替运行,这种进程特性称为(b)
a、动态性。
b、并发性。
c、异步性。
d、同步性。
5.进程在执行过程中状态是会发生变化,不可能出现的状态变化情况是:(d)
a、运行变为就绪。
b、运行变为等待。
c、等待变为就绪。
d、等待变为运行。
6.当一进程由于某个原因让出处理器时,把与处理器有关的各种信息保留在该进程控制块pcb的(d)区域中。
a、表示信息。
b、说明信息。
c、管理信息。
d、现场信息。
7.在固定分区存储管理中,每个连续分区的大小是:(d)
a、相同的。
b、随作业的长度而固定。
c、不相同的。
d、预先固定划分的,可以相同,也可以不同。
8.在可变分区存储管理中,系统收回已完成作业的主存空间,并与相邻空间合成,可造成空间区数减1的情况是(a);
a、有上邻空闲区,也有下邻空闲区。
b、无上邻空闲区,也无下邻空闲区。
c、有上邻空闲区,但无下邻空闲区。
d、无上林空闲区,但有下邻空闲区。
9.把空闲区按长度递增顺序登记到空闲区表中,便于实现贮存分配的算法是:(c)
a、先进先出分配算法。
b、最先适应分配算法。
c、最优适应分配算法。
d、最坏适应分配算法。
10.一个文件的绝对路径名是从(d)开始,逐步沿着每一级子目录向下。最后到达指定文件的整个通路与所有子目录名组成一个字符串。
a、当前目录。
b、二级目录。
c、多级目录。
d、根目录。
11.在页式虚拟存储管理中,当发现要访问的页面不在主存时,则由硬件发出(d)
a、输入输出中断。
b、实时中断。
c、越界中断。
d、缺页中断。
20.银行家算法在解决思索问题时是用了(b)方法。
a、预防死锁。
b、避免死锁。
c、检测死锁。
d、解除死锁。
2、填空题(10个空,每空2分,共20分)
1.在批处理兼分时的系统中,操作系统总是按分时系统控制方式运行前台作业。按批处理控制方式运行后台作业。
2.文件的逻辑结构类型包括流式文件和记录式文件。
3.设备管理中数据传输方式包括循环测试方式、中断处理方式、dma方式和通道方式。
4.按保护级别,文件可以分为只读文件,读写文件、执行文件和不保护文件。
5.常用的文件保护实现方法包括存取控制矩阵、存取控制表、权限表和口令核对法。
6.一般地,设备管理中的缓冲池位于内存中。
7.在cpu启动通道后,由 i/o通道来执行通道程序,完成i/o任务。
8.实现文件长度可变的磁盘文件物理结构是链接结构和索引结构。
9.参与死锁的进程至少 2 个。
3、简答题(5小题,每小题4分,共20分)
1.假设cpu访问一次内存时间为100ns,访问一次页表为100ns,访问一次快表的时间为20ns,若快表的命中率为90%。求不采用快表和采用快表的有效访问时间。
2.有一个程序要将128×128的数组的初始值置为“0”,数组中的每一个元素为一个字,如果页面大小为128个字,数组中的元素按行编址存放。假定只有一个主存块可用来存放数组,初始状态为空,数组初始化为0的程序分别如下:
a程序)int=[128][128];
int i,j;
for(i=0;i<127;i++)
for(i=0;i<127;i++)
a[i][j]=0;
(b程序 ) int a[128][128]
int i,j;
for(j=0;j<127;j++)
for(i=0;i<127;i++)
a[i][j]=0;
上述两个程序执行时,各产生多少缺页中断?
整个数组占用128个页面:128*128/128=128
缺页中断:(a程序)128*128*128次缺页中断。
(b程序) 128次缺页中断。
3.假定磁带的存储密度为每英寸400个字符,每个逻辑记录长尾80字符,记录间隙是0.6英寸。问:
1)不采用成组技术磁盘存储空间的利用率?
2)采用5个记录为一组的成组技术,磁盘存储空间的利用率?
4.将下面存储设备,存储结构,存取方式间的关系图补充完整:
5.假设有一个盘面,共有5个柱面,每个柱面10个磁盘,每个盘面8个扇区。请用位示图对其存储空间进行管理,子长是8位,求出第30字的第7位对应的柱面号,磁头号,扇区号。
共有5*10*8=400 个物理块。
块号=30*8+7=247
柱面号=[块号/柱面上的块数]=247/(10*8)
磁头号=247%80/8
4、综合应用题(4小题,每小题10分,共40分)
1.如果一个进程在执行过程中按下列页号依次访问:
进程固定占用3块内存空间,问采用opt(最优页面淘汰)算法以及lrh算法时所产生的缺页中断次数(要求画图,写出详细过程)。
2.某系统采用页式存储管理方法,主存储器容量为256mb,分成64k个块。某用户作业有4页,其页号依次为0,1,2,3被分别放在主存块号为2,4,1,6的块中。要求:
1)要求读作业的页表;
2)计算相对地址[0,100]对应的绝对地址(方括号内的第一元素为页号,第二元素为页内地址)
3.磁盘有100个柱面,编号为0-99,磁头当前正处于50柱面,对于如下序列:
在先来先服务算法、最短寻址时间优先算法下的磁头移动顺序。(要求画图,写出详细过程)
4.某工厂有一个可以存放设备的仓库,总共可以放8台设备。生产部门生产的每一台设备都必须入库。
销售部门可以从仓库提出设备**客户。设备的入库和出库都必须借助运输工具。现只有一套运输工具,每次只能运输一台设备。
用信号量和p,v操作实现以下进程的并发工作。(直接在答题纸上的程序中添加)
操作系统试卷
全国2002年4月高等教育自学考试。操作系统试题。课程 02326 一 单项选择题 每小题1分,共20分 在每小题列出的四个选项中,选出一个正确答案,并将正确答案的号码写在题干后面的括号内。1.关于操作系统的叙述 是不正确的。a.管理资源的程序b.管理用户程序执行的程序 c.能使系统资源提高效率的程...
操作系统试卷
a 联机b 脱机c 假脱机d 自动。13 作业调度选中一个作业后,按作业控制说明书中第一个作业步的要求创建该作业的进程,并使进程的状态为。a 就绪b 运行c 等待d 收容。14 为两个相互独立源程序进行编译的两个进程,它们之间的关系正确的是。a 它们可以并发执行,两者逻辑上有依赖关系。b 它们可以并...
操作系统试卷A
操作系统 a 试卷。一 单项选择题 本大题共15小题,每小题2分,共30分 在每小题列出的四个选项中只有一个选项是符合题目要求的,请将正确选项前的字母填在题后的括号内。1 用户程序中的输入,输出操作实际上是由 完成。a 程序设计语言 b 编译系统 c 操作系统 d 标准库程序。2 计算机系统中判别是...